一、存储过程函数详解
CREATE PROCEDURE : 声明存储过程
delete_matches:方法名用来调用
IN uid INTEGER :传参uid,INTEGER 类型。
- IN 输入参数:表示调用者向过程传入值(传入值可以是字面量或变量)
- OUT 输出参数:表示过程向调用者传出值(可以返回多个值)(传出值只能是变量)
- INOUT 输入输出参数:既表示调用者向过程传入值,又表示过程向调用者传出值(值只能是变量)
BEGIN :开始
语句块{
}
END:结束
二、编写存储过程
CREATE PROCEDURE delete_matches (IN uid INTEGER)
BEGIN
DELETE FROM da_city_stlstj WHERE id = uid;
END
三、调用测试
CALL delete_matches(1);
成功结果如下↓